CYP Good Friday Night Walk – Fri-Sat 18-19 April 

Hosted by the Diocese of Parramatta’s youth ministry office, the Good Friday Night Walk is an annual pilgrimage attended by hundreds of young people across the Diocese. Pilgrims travel from Blacktown to Parramatta, throughout the night of Good Friday and into Holy Saturday. Find out more and register: parracatholic.org/events/gfnw/

Diocese of Parramatta Tribunal Office    

The Tribunal of the Catholic Church in the Diocese of Parramatta is open Monday to Friday, 9am to 5pm, to offer advice and assistance regarding marriage annulments and dissolution of marriages. Interviews are preferably conducted in person with Zoom and telephone interviews in special circumstances. Please contact the Tribunal Office on (02) 8838 3480 or email tribunal@parracatholic.org.

Mount Schoenstatt Monthly Shrine Time for men 

Men at the Shrine is a monthly hour for men at the Schoenstatt Shrine in Mulgoa, held on the second Wednesday of the month from 8-9pm. The hour includes a brief reflection, silent personal prayer and the opportunity for confession. The Shrine has been a place of pilgrimage in the diocese since 1968 and in 2025 is also one of the three locations in the diocese to gain the Jubilee Indulgence.
